  • How to Use the Microsoft Authenticator App

    The Microsoft Authenticator app has various features that can help you use your accounts more securely, therefore avoiding threats like compromised and stolen passwords. It also acts as a backup in case you forgot your password, especially for accounts that you didn’t use for a long time.

    Your Microsoft account can be used to access Windows, xbox Live, Hotmail, Azure as well as many businesses. So it is important to keep your account secure.

    These are four main ways how you can use the Microsoft Authenticator app:

    • Two-factor Authentication – In this method, one of the factors is your account’s password. Once you sign in with your username and password, you will need to further approve the sign-in via notification or a unique verification code.

     

    • Code Generation – You can use this app as a code generator when signing in to an app that supports code generation.

     

    • Phone Sign-in – Another version of two-factor authentication where you can sign in without a password. It uses your phone’s verification methods like fingerprint, PIN, and face recognition.

     

    • One-Time Passwords – Aside from two-factor verification, the Microsoft Authenticator app also supports time-based, one-time passwords (TOTP) standards.

    If you’re a part of a work or school organization, you might be required to use the Microsoft Authenticator app to gain access to your organization’s documents and other confidential data. A complete setup of this app is required to use as a trusted verification method.
